Choose based on who you are.
Finnish artists, associations, nonprofits, and startups running reward-based or donation crowdfunding in euro who want a domestic platform that handles Finnish fundraising-permit requirements.
- ✓Finland's largest home-grown crowdfunding platform, established since 2012.
- ✓Supports both reward-based and donation-based crowdfunding.
- ✓Handles the Finnish fundraising-permit requirements for donation campaigns.
- ✓All-or-nothing model refunds backers in full if a campaign misses its target.
Italian registered nonprofits (ETS) and the individuals, athletes, and companies fundraising on their behalf — especially charity-sport campaigns tied to major Italian marathons and tax-deductible giving.
- ✓Beneficiaries are always vetted registered Italian nonprofits (ETS).
- ✓Italian fiscal receipts with IRPEF deductions and Art Bonus support.
- ✓Deep charity-sport program tied to major Italian marathons.
- ✓Broad payment support: cards, PayPal, Stripe, Satispay, Apple Pay, Google Pay.
